Finally!! 4th of July coyote
« on: July 06, 2011, 10:52:33 AM »
Well after about a year, and multiple stands, it all finally came together. I decided to try a spot that i hadnt hunted coyote before, only turkey. I left my cabin on the quad at about 6:15 p.m. and was all set up by 7 o'clock. The spot looked good to me, even though i dont really know what to look for besides knowing that coyotes are in the area. Wind was in my favor, had a good view of everything around me, so i sat for about 5 minutes before doing any calling so i could let things settle down. After about 7-8 minutes of distress calls, a coyote came running over the hill about 300 yards away. It stopped and looked,. then took off running again towards me, it disappeared in the trees so that gave me time to get all set up, shew popped out of the trees about 150 yards still running, as soon as she got broadside i stopped her and bang....i missed! So she kinda trotted a little ways, and i stopped her again, this time i anchored her. She dropped, and started biting and snarling, then she let off a few whines, and that was it...i finally called in, and killed my first coyote! She was about a 25lbs female, shot her with my ruger .243win
